17 Oct 1944

United Kingdom
  • Some 70 houses were damaged in the village of Kirby-le-Soken in Essex, England, United Kingdom when a V-1 came down. This date marked an increase in the number of flying bombs launched over the rest of the month. More night fighters were now sent up to the east coast. ww2dbase [V-Weapons Campaign | Vergeltungswaffe 1 | Kirby-le-Soken, England | HM]
